1. Introduction: The Role of AI in the Green Energy Revolution
The global energy landscape is undergoing a massive transformation. With the rapid depletion of fossil fuels and the alarming rise of greenhouse gas emissions, the world is turning toward renewable energy sources like solar, wind, hydro, and geothermal power.
However, managing these sources efficiently is a complex challenge due to their intermittent and unpredictable nature — for example, solar power depends on sunlight, and wind power depends on weather conditions.
This is where Artificial Intelligence (AI) steps in as a revolutionary force. AI systems can analyze massive datasets, forecast power generation, manage grids intelligently, and optimize energy storage, making renewable energy more reliable, affordable, and sustainable. By integrating machine learning (ML) and data analytics, AI enables real-time decision-making and smart automation in every aspect of renewable energy production and distribution.
2. Core Applications of AI in Renewable Energy
a. Power Generation Forecasting
One of the biggest challenges in renewable energy is predicting how much power will be generated at a given time.
AI algorithms process data from satellites, weather sensors, and historical energy output to forecast solar irradiance and wind speed patterns with remarkable accuracy.
For instance, neural networks can predict how much solar energy a region will produce tomorrow, allowing energy operators to balance supply and demand.
These forecasts help avoid blackouts and ensure stable energy delivery to consumers.
Companies such as Google’s DeepMind have used AI to predict wind energy output 36 hours in advance, improving overall grid efficiency by nearly 20%.
b. Smart Grid Optimization
AI plays a crucial role in smart grid management, ensuring energy flows seamlessly between producers, distributors, and consumers.
Traditional grids operate on fixed schedules, but AI-driven smart grids dynamically adjust based on real-time conditions.
Machine learning algorithms analyze consumption data, weather forecasts, and device performance to automatically reroute energy to areas with high demand or potential shortages.
These grids can also integrate multiple renewable sources, reducing wastage and improving sustainability.
For example, if a wind farm suddenly generates excess energy, AI can instruct the system to store it in batteries or divert it to nearby regions.
c. Energy Storage and Battery Management
Energy storage is vital for renewable energy reliability, as solar and wind sources are not always consistent.
AI enhances battery management systems (BMS) by predicting charge/discharge cycles, optimizing storage duration, and preventing degradation.
Predictive analytics can determine the best time to store or release energy based on real-time electricity prices and demand patterns.
In large-scale storage facilities, AI helps extend battery lifespan and reduce operational costs by detecting faults early and balancing load distribution.
This is particularly important for nations transitioning to 100% renewable grids, where energy storage stability determines overall reliability.
d. Predictive Maintenance and Fault Detection
Maintenance is one of the most expensive and time-consuming aspects of renewable energy operations.
AI-powered predictive maintenance systems analyze sensor data from turbines, panels, and power lines to identify early signs of malfunction.
For instance, vibration or temperature anomalies in a wind turbine can indicate potential bearing failure.
By detecting such issues early, AI reduces downtime, prevents costly repairs, and increases energy output.
Drones equipped with AI-based image recognition can also inspect solar panels or wind blades for cracks or dust accumulation, improving accuracy and safety without manual labor.
e. Sustainable Energy Consumption and Policy Planning
AI not only improves production but also enables energy-efficient consumption.
Smart home systems powered by AI automatically adjust lighting, heating, and appliance use based on real-time electricity supply, minimizing energy waste.
Governments and organizations use AI models to simulate energy policies, forecast carbon emissions, and design sustainable development roadmaps.
By analyzing consumption trends, policymakers can prioritize renewable investments and design smarter subsidy systems.
This data-driven governance ensures a smooth and equitable transition to clean energy economies.
3. Benefits and Future Outlook
a. Increased Efficiency
AI maximizes energy efficiency by reducing losses during generation, storage, and distribution.
Predictive models optimize every step — from solar tracking angles to grid energy routing — ensuring maximum utilization of resources.
b. Cost Reduction
Automation through AI reduces manual labor and minimizes downtime in renewable systems, significantly lowering maintenance and operational expenses.
Predictive models help avoid energy overproduction, saving millions for utility companies.
c. Environmental Sustainability
By balancing renewable energy sources and cutting reliance on fossil fuels, AI plays a key role in reducing carbon footprints and mitigating climate change.
d. The Future Ahead
In the coming decades, AI will serve as the backbone of the renewable revolution.
As global energy systems become more decentralized, millions of small producers — homes, buildings, and vehicles — will generate and share energy.
AI will coordinate this complex network.
